Southern Maryland Chapter

The CCA Southern Maryland Chapter is made up of conservation minded anglers who all share a common goal to conserve the Chesapeake Bay’s resources in order to maintain successful fisheries. Our members fish in a diverse area that includes the Potomac, Patuxent, main Bay, and many parts of the Eastern Shore.

The chapter meets every other month, rotating between Calvert, St. Mary's, and Charles counties. RSVP to the upcoming chapter meetings below.

Chapter volunteers support the LRAC program's successful collaboration with Calvert County Public Schools (CCPS), in which every 5th grader in the county participates in hands on habitat creation in the form of artificial reef ball builds.
